My name is Sue Morton. I have been breeding since 2002 and am located in Davoren Park, South Australia. When I was young I showed miniature dachshunds under the prefix 'Sundown'; however I first became involved with cats after my daughter wanted a kitten. We ended up with a part pedigree boy named Caramello who went on to win numerous prizes in the cat showing community, with such prizes as 'Best Part Pedigree' and 'Domestic in Show' at the Royal Adelaide Show. From then on my obsession for cats grew, landing me with a little chocolate pointed Siamese and Oriental which led me to show and breed them up until 2017. In 2005 I had a friend who's husband passed away, and I was offered a little black Cornish Rex which I had much success with cat showing. This lead to my love for the breed, to which I am still showing and breeding. I am a small cattery of only 2 males and 3 females which are as much a part of my family as they are of my breeding program. I only breed one litter each year so kittens are sometimes available. All kittens I breed are born and raised inside. Please do not ask for a breeding cat unless you are a registered breeder as they all come desexed, as well as vaccinated and microchipped.
